Bunbury International Motorsports Complex

Project
Proponent: 
Perth International Motorsports Management
Proposal description: 

The proposal is to construct an international standard motorsports complex in Picton, near Bunbury. This comprises a racing circuit, pit area, rally and off-road testing facility, grandstand, control centre, and associated roads and car parks.

It is intended that accommodation and a racing technology park will be constructed at a later date. However, these will be subject to separate assessment, as will the use of the complex for other purposes, such as concerts.
